Locating North Palm Beach Arrest Records

Public arrest records are part of the openness of the American criminal justice system, and North Palm Beach is no exception. You can access North Palm Beach arrest records through several methods:

  1. Police Department Records Request: Submit a formal records request to the North Palm Beach Police Department. It’s essential to provide as much detail as possible about the arrest record you’re seeking. This method may require processing time.
  2. Online Databases: Check online public record databases. Many online platforms compile public arrest records, making them available for the public. Ensure the website you choose is reliable and secure.
  3. County Courthouse: You can also request arrest records from Palm Beach County. As the Palm Beach County court manages legal proceedings, they have comprehensive records of arrests.
